IMAGE FORMING APPARATUS, INK SET, AND IMAGE FORMING METHOD
The present disclosure provides an image forming apparatus that improves washing fastness of an image forming portion of a fabric on which a discharge printing ink and a color ink are ejected. An image forming apparatus of the present disclosure includes: a color ink ejector; a discharge printing ink ejector; and a controller, wherein the color ink ejector is configured to eject a color ink containing an aqueous resin emulsion on a fabric, the discharge printing ink ejector is configured to eject a discharge printing ink containing a reducing agent on the fabric, and the controller is configured to control the color ink ejector and the discharge printing ink ejector to eject the color ink on the fabric in a first step, and after the first step, to eject the discharge printing ink on the fabric in a second step.

FLUID SET FOR TEXTILE PRINTING
A fluid set includes a pre-treatment composition, an ink composition, and an overcoat composition. The pre-treatment composition includes a multivalent metal salt and an aqueous vehicle. The ink composition includes a pigment, a polyurethane-based binder, and an aqueous ink vehicle. An overcoat composition includes a blocked polyisocyanate crosslinker and an aqueous overcoat vehicle.

INK JET RECORDING APPARATUS
An ink jet recording apparatus includes: an aqueous ink composition; a liquid ejecting head having a nozzle for discharging the aqueous ink composition; and a cap member for protecting the nozzle, where: the aqueous ink composition has a surface tension of 40 mN/m or less; the aqueous ink composition contains a wax having a melting point of 100° C. or more; and the cap member has a coating film containing a silicone defoamer on a contact surface with the nozzle.

Stabilization of sodium dithionite by means of various additives
The present invention relates to a method for reducing or preventing the decomposition of a composition Z comprising Z1 a salt of dithionous acid in an amount ranging from 50 to 100 wt % and optionally Z2 an additive selected from the group consisting of alkali metal carbonate, alkaline earth metal carbonate, alkali metal or alkaline earth metal tripolyphosphate (Na.sub.5P.sub.3O.sub.10), alkali metal or alkaline earth metal sulfite, disulfite or sulfate, dextrose and complexing agents in a combined amount ranging from 0.0001 to 40 wt %, which comprises contacting the components Z1 and optionally Z2 in the solid and/or dry or solvent-dissolved or -suspended state with at least one of the following compounds V in the solid and/or dry or solvent-dissolved or -suspended state, wherein the compounds V are selected from the group consisting of: (a) oxides of the alkali metals lithium, sodium, potassium, rubidium, cesium, or of magnesium, (b) sodium tetrahydroborate (NaBH.sub.4), (c) anhydrous copper(II) sulfate (Cu(SO.sub.4)), phosphorus pentoxide and (d) basic amino acids arginine, lysine, histidine, wherein the solvent for Z1, optionally Z2 and V is practically water-free.
